texte = don't you want &[SearchString] added to the arguments of that shownext link?otherwise how is the link supposed to know what to search for?See the docs on [shownext]...:-)-JohnTim Robinson wrote:> OK, I'll admit it! I'm a bit vague when it comes to search criteria, but I could certainly use some help :-/>> I've got a VERY simple 3 field database (SKU, subject, text).>> My search page has the option to search the two text fields, or to do a Find All.>> My results page (results.tpl) has the following Search context at the top of the page.>> [search db=imagine_tech.db&[formvariables name=_&exact=F][getchars start=2][name][/getchars]=[url][value][/url]&[/formvariables]startat=[url][startat][/url]&max=10]>> This works fine for the search EXCEPT for the following.> I have a [shownext] command at the bottom of the results.tpl page which is supposed to show the next group of records if there are more than 10 records returned (my set maximum).>> [shownext]>
Show Items [start]-[end]> [/shownext]>> But, It doesn't return anything when I click on this link....!>> If I add this geSKUdata=2 to the search context making the following:>> [search db=imagine_tech.db&[formvariables name=_&exact=F][getchars start=2][name][/getchars]=[url][value][/url]&[/formvariables]startat=[url][startat][/url]&max=10&geSKUdata=2]>> ... then the [shownext] link work PERFECTLY, BUT, then an ordinary text search doesn't work at all! It simply does a Find All.... What is going on?>> I hope I've explained myself properly.>> Any help or explanation greatly appreciated.>> Regards,> Tim>> Tim Robinson> Art Director> imagine online> tim@imagine.au.com> http://www.imagine.au.com>> -------------------------------------------------------------> This message is sent to you because you are subscribed to> the mailing list
